Hello SunnyFL_CH-R,The door trim can be removed, but you have to remove the entire door panel - I learned this while I was installing sound deadening. The colored trim has 6-7 screws on the inside of the door panel that have to be removed, and then the trim easily pops out. I took my trim to have it color-matched at a local hardware store, so that I have it for painting parts/accessories for future projects.
I used a YouTube video for reference, but the door panel comes off after you remove 3 screws (2 under the window controls - window controls pop out with a bit of force, and 1 behind a small plastic cover behind the interior door handle).
